About this trial
This study is a prospective, observational clinical research conducted at the Department of Periodontology, Faculty of Dentistry, Necmettin Erbakan University. The study aims to evaluate periodontal records routinely obtained before treatment and throughout the treatment process from individuals who visited the clinic and were planned for non-surgical periodontal treatment. Within the scope of the research, the effectiveness of periodontal treatments will be evaluated solely through non-invasive clinical periodontal parameters. No additional invasive procedures will be performed during the study; only records obtained during routine periodontal examinations and treatments at the clinic will be used.
Eligibility criteria
Qualifiers
Being between 18 and 65 years of age
Not being pregnant or breastfeeding
Smoking less than 10 cigarettes a day
Having a clinical record of periodontitis (stages 3 and 4 according to the 2017 classification)
Disqualifiers
Individuals with uncontrolled systemic disease
Patients diagnosed with diabetes
Individuals under 18 years of age
Individuals who smoke 10 or more cigarettes a day
